What You Can Expect

As a Real-Time Optimization II, you will be part of a collaborative team responsible for executing real-time dispatch strategies and supporting the 24/7 monitoring and management of a portfolio of ENGIE and third-party-owned generation assets. This role involves the real-time purchase and sale of energy, fulfillment of ancillary service obligations, and continuous optimization for financial performance across the ERCOT and CAISO markets. This position is based in Houston, TX, and reports to the Real-Time Optimization Manage

 

  • Monitor SCADA systems, alerts, and market data to track Battery Energy Storage System (BESS) performance, operational conditions, and market positions in real time
  • Make and execute real-time market decisions that drive P&L performance, meet scheduled obligations, and align with long-term strategies, including submitting bids and offers into ISO systems.
  • Ensure compliance with ISO regulations by maintaining up-to-date knowledge of operational practices and integrating them into daily operations
  • Serve as the primary point of contact with plant control room operators and maintain accurate logs documenting unit availability, dispatch levels, market prices, and other critical operational data
